Monochrome Echo 64 Souls EP Out Now

Okay so some of you are probably wondering what/who the hell Monochrome Echo is, right?

Just over a year ago I decided to start a new project producing electronic music. I put together a little studio setup centred around Ableton. I wanted to separate this project from any previous/ongoing solo projects and so came up with the name Monochrome Echo. There’s a Facebook page, you can follow me on Soundcloud and Twitter as Monochrome Echo too.

Quite early on I started posting some tracks on the collaborative music site Blend.io, as well as submitting entries to some of their remix and production challenges. Blend has been fantastic for learning new skills and making new contacts. Some of my best tracks have been collaborations with other musicians and producers from all around the world. I highly recommend you take look if you’re into making electronic music.

A couple of months ago Blend contacted me about the possibility of releasing an EP of my music on their label. So I set to work…

64 Souls Blend Cover

I chose three tracks from my Blend page and three additional tracks I had been working on and the 64 Souls EP was born. 64 Souls was officially released on Friday 13th on Blend Records and is now available via all digital platforms including iTunes and Beatport.
